Who Is Bob Baffert
Bob Baffert is an American Thoroughbred horse trainer known for conditioning multiple Triple Crown winners and major stakes champions. He has trained horses that earned hundreds of millions in racing purses and holds a prominent position in the sport of horse racing. His career spans decades of success at tracks across the United States and internationally, with a record of high-profile wins in the Kentucky Derby, Preakness Stakes, and other Grade 1 races. Career Highlights and Major Wins
Triple Crown and Classic Victories
Baffert trained American Pharoah, the 2015 Triple Crown winner, and Justify, who swept the Triple Crown in 2018. He has also trained horses that won the Kentucky Derby, Preakness Stakes, and other major races, building a record of consistent success in the sport’s most prestigious events. His horses have earned top finishes in the Breeders’ Cup and other championship races, reinforcing his reputation as one of the leading trainers in modern racing.
